Oceola "Scotty" Scott Boomer's Obituary
CLAUDE SERVICES- 10:00 am, Monday, March 27, 2006, at the First United Methodist Church in Claude, with Rev. Janet Edwards, Pastor, officiating. INTERMENT- with Eastern Star rites in Claude Cemetery Mrs. Boomer was born on a farm between Claude and Goodnight to Samuel and Beulah Scott on March 25, 1915. She married Lynn Boomer on September 5, 1936 in Claude, Texas. She was a life long resident of Claude. She was a homemaker. She was active in the community throughout her life and also was involved with many volunteer activities. She had been past worthy matron of the Claude Eastern Star, and a member for well over 50 years. She was also a member of Methodist Unity Study Club, the Friday bridge group, Library and Cemetery Boards, and for years served on Meals on Wheels. She was a member of First United Methodist Church in Claude for more than 50 years. She was preceded in death by her husband, Lynn on February 14, 1972 and 1 great grandchild, Jada Bates. She is survived by 1 daughter, Ginger Kennedy of Ft. Worth; 1 son, Scott Boomer of Claude; 3 grandchildren, Kelli Kennedy and husband Frank, Kimberley Kennedy Cuero and husband Ruben, Kathy Sanchez and husband Ram; and 5 great grandchildren, Neenah Cuero, Leelah Cuero, Hunter Bates, Cynthia Sanchez, and Mary Beth Sanchez. The family requests that memorials be sent to the First United Methodist Church in Claude, Claude Volunteer Fire Department, Claude EMS or a favorite charity.
